Moscow: On Sunday, Russian President Vladimir Putin asserted that Russia would always be ready to help resolve a migrant predicament on the border between Belarus and Poland. “We are inclined to help it by all means if of course, anything would depend on us,” Putin quoted in an interview to a state TV channel. He also rebutted the involvement of Moscow and Minsk and blamed the West for the crisis in Iraq and Afghanistan.
